CLOT in conjunction with Japanese label Devilock recently collaborated on Devilclot Pop-Up store in Hong Kong. Every week, new products will be released under the Devilclot brand and this week, they produced a pair of Devilclot x Levi’s denim which was released on November 23rd. We haven’t seen a line up like this for a while where over 700 people were in line for a chance to grab a pair of the Devilclot x Levi’s denim. The Bearbrick World Wide Tour 2007 started taking place this weekend on November 23rd at the Parco Factory in Japan. For this event, Medicom Toy has worked with several top streetwear brands including Bape, Stussy, Roar and Fragment Design for some collaboration event tees. The tees were only sold at the event so your only chance to get these is through a third party source.

Levi’s Fenom is a Japan exclusive line created in conjunction with global trend setter, Hiroshi Fujiwara. They have recently released a pair of Fenom Chinos that features the fragment design logo on the back pocket. The chinos come in three different color and are now available at Tab Device in Japan.
